Tweet WreathHere a wreath I made for my friend that just celebrated her 1 year on Twitter. It was kind of a silly thing we ended up doing for each other, cause we noticed that our one year “twitterversary” was approaching. She made me a cute card with a bird on it from scrapbooking supplies, cause she is into scrapping, and so when her’s came up, I took one of the wreaths I had made from the grapevines growing on my back fence, and decorated it up.

She really liked it alot, and has it hanging in her kitchen. Which kind of shocked me, casue I just threw it together, being the ADDcrafter I am. The bird is felt, and the blanket stitch is the fastest sticth there is. The vine is twisted  sticks, and the bows are ripped fabric, cause I couldn’t find my sissors  :)

Not that I’m underminding it, cause I’m actually proud of how it turned out myself too. But I really do love that the rustic country feel for things suits my ADD traits so much…it makes me wonder how many people really had ADD way back then when these things were first done, and are now considered a “style”.. call it rustic/country/shabby chic/redneck/or ADDStyle..it’s me.

Grapevine wreaths

We are clearing off the back fence of grapevines that are causing the fence to actually be pulled down. So Instead of burning them all, I decided to make wreaths and baskets of them. IT’s a great ADDCraft because you don’t need to worry about attention to detail. the more messy and half thrown together they look the better they are :) I hope to post a basket picture soon, but right now the wreaths are only getting a small amount of my attention. I have been falling behind and I need to break ground on the garden before the strawberry plants die! The basket in the workshop, almost finished. I’m thinking I’m going to tag them and put them at the end of the driveway with a sale sign and see what happens.
